Manor of Lestremec and Etang du Moulin Neuf

After walking along woodland paths to admire the manor "Manoir de Lestremec", we skirt the pond "Etang du Moulin Neuf".
A short detour to enjoy the peace and quiet of the chapel "Chapelle de Kelou Mad" before returning along the greenway.

The Pont-L'Abbé water tower as a landmark.

Description of the walk

"Maison du pays bigouden", at the roundabout at the entrance of Pont-l'Abbé, when you come from Quimper.

VTT3 and Yellow markings.

(S/E) From the car park, use the pedestrian crossing to bypass the traffic circle and head towards the west ring road (D785). Be careful, walk carefully on the grassy strip.

(1) Turn right onto the first path (2 letterboxes). Follow this path through a pine woodland. Pass a small rustic wash-house on your left and continue until you meet the old "Transbigouden" GR®34H railroad line.

(2) Turn right on this greenway (signposted Quimper 17km) for a few hundred metres, then at the signpost "Circuit de l'étang du Moulin Neuf", leave it to turn left and take the parallel path which goes back behind a house. Follow the Yellow markings. The path skirts a vast meadow on the right, then turns left to reach a road.

Off road

Turn right and follow this small road. Ignore two roads leading to farms on your left. Pass a rustic cross on your right. At the next crossroads, continue straight on towards "Plonéour-Lanvern", leaving behind the signposted route to Tréméoc town.

(3) Turn left then right to reach the entrance to the manor "Manoir de Lestrémec". This manor is privately owned, but if the owners are around, they'll be happy to show you around.
Retrace your steps, cross the small wooded area and join the yellow-marked path again close to the road.

Yellow Marking

Follow it to the right to reach the windmill "Moulin Neuf lake". Cross a small parking area, then turn left to walk along the water's edge towards the dam.

(4) When you see the dam, leave the edge of the pond and turn left to reach a staircase. Climb up, leaving the path on the left, and continue on to a footbridge that leads around the dam.
Follow the pathway, which is currently being restored to its natural course (October 2020).

Unmarked

(5) At the end of this footbridge, turn left, leaving on your right the signposted path that continues around the pond. Follow a path that skirts the swampy area you've crossed. Opposite a meadow, turn right up a sunken track which leads to a road at a place called Coatellen.
Turn left to enjoy the bucolic setting of the chapel "Chapelle Notre Dame de Bonne Nouvelle" (Kelou Mad in Breton dialect).

(6) Go back to the road. Take the first street on the left that goes around the Ty Coat housing estate, and continue along this road back to the one you left.
Turn left to go over the bypass and take the first path on the left, which goes behind some houses and joins the road "Route Saint-Julien". Follow this road down to a small roundabout.

Yellow Marking

(7) Turn left to take the green path, which runs alongside the stream coming from the dam. Continue until you reach a marker at a staircase.

(8) Go up and turn right. Continue along this path, which runs below the Pont-L'Abbé water tower. Look out for an old wash-house and fountain on your right. This leads to the street "Rue Ster Vad", which you follow until you reach the street "Rue Pen Enez".

(9) Turn right, then left into the street "Rue de Menez", which goes uphill. The street continues along a wide tree-lined path. Ignore the pedestrian and bicycle access to the water park on your right. Continue along a property on your right.
Exit onto the D785 road opposite (1). Turn right to reach the car park. Be careful when driving along this road.(S/E)

Practical information

Most of the route is on footpaths or quiet country roads.
A busier section at the end: road Saint-Julien.

In fine weather, the area around the pond is busy, but quiet.

Hello,
I wouldn't recommend this tour to families with children or dogs, and quite simply I wouldn't recommend this tour to anyone. Dangerous and lacking in interest. At the start, the car park is convenient, although the exit afterwards is tricky depending on the time of day... The building here is disused. At the first pedestrian crossing, it is best to continue straight ahead into the hotel zone and take the first path on the left that runs alongside a hotel, then turn right to join the route with a pretty path through the woods. Then, on the route du manoir, there are some very narrow verges, and although there are few cars, they drive fast and the distance on the road is too long (why not change the route by heading east?). We left the road at point 35 on the map, and took a path to the left, without going to the manor house. We arrived at the dam reservoir, where work began in February 2023 for a 15-month period, and the work seemed to be coming to an end as we passed by. Yes, for the 2 points of interest, a nice little chapel and probably the manor house, but then from the bridge over the main road and all the way along Route Saint-Julien, no pavements or "safe" verges, really very dangerous. Too much tarmac and too many passages through housing estates. The final stretch can be made along a small path on the right at the last little track you come across to avoid going along the main road again. This route either needs to be fundamentally modified or deleted, thank you in advance as the author has the skills to do so. And happy hiking with Visorando!

Date of walk: 1 October 2020
I only walked the circuit around the Moulin Neuf lake: a very pleasant walk of around 7 km, in the greenery, on flat ground, so suitable for all ages, with the whole family, with the great pleasure of observing a host of birds on the lake: coots, swans, ducks, white and grey herons... No road noise, just the serenity of the place.
New developments are under way, with wooden footbridges that will further enhance the setting and the pleasure of walking there.
